GEE wrote:It sure would be nice to have an official update to his injury, and know when he might be returning.


if you go by the Paul George time-table it's 8 months. So that would be sometime in November. Now, Nurk is 60-70 pounds heavier than PG; and George was just a shell of himself and played like crap in the few games he played before the season ended. And Nurkic has had two different broken legs

my guess would be anywhere from December to the all-star break. But maybe he's a faster healer than PG

Yeah, I think the mental part of this injury can't be overstated enough. Same with Hayward. Even once you return from this injury and are totally physically healthy, the mental part of it can take 6-12month after the physical part to trust that leg again.

I'm more concerned about if he has some underlying bone weakness condition. I don't think it is super common for a guy to have multiple broken leg bones like he has.

I think it's hard to say how long it would take Nurkic to be mentally ready but he did play on a broken fibula before so he seems to be pretty tough in that way. Then again a tibia vs a fibula injury is very different and who knows how that affects him. It is good to see him walking around lately. From what I've heard, bearing weight on it is supposed to help it heal.
